Hammer  1.0.0
Helicity Amplitude Module for Matrix Element Reweighting
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Hammer::ProvidersRepo Member List

This is the complete list of members for Hammer::ProvidersRepo, including all inherited members.

_amplitudesHammer::ProvidersRepoprivate
_FFErrProvidersHammer::ProvidersRepoprivate
_formFactorsHammer::ProvidersRepoprivate
_groupHammer::SettingsConsumerprotected
_ownedSettingsHammer::SettingsConsumerprotected
_partialWidthsHammer::ProvidersRepoprivate
_ratesHammer::ProvidersRepoprivate
_schemeDefsHammer::ProvidersRepoprivate
_schemeNamesFromPrefixGroupHammer::ProvidersRepoprivate
_settingHandlerHammer::SettingsConsumerprotected
_settingPathHammer::SettingsConsumerprotected
_WCProvidersHammer::ProvidersRepoprivate
addRefs() const Hammer::SettingsConsumervirtual
addSetting(const std::string &name, const T &defaultValue)Hammer::SettingsConsumerprotected
checkFFPrefixAndGroup(const FFPrefixGroup &value) const Hammer::ProvidersRepo
defineSettings()Hammer::ProvidersRepoprivatevirtual
duplicateFormFactor(HadronicUID processId, FFIndex baseIndex, const std::string &newLabel)Hammer::ProvidersRepo
fixWCValues()Hammer::ProvidersRepoprivate
getAllFFErrProviders() const Hammer::ProvidersRepo
getAllWCProviders() const Hammer::ProvidersRepo
getAmplitude(PdgId parent, const std::vector< PdgId > &daughters, const std::vector< PdgId > &granddaughters={}) const Hammer::ProvidersRepovirtual
getFFErrLabel(const FFPrefixGroup &process) const Hammer::ProvidersRepo
getFFErrProvider(const FFPrefixGroup &process) const Hammer::ProvidersRepo
getFFGroups() const Hammer::ProvidersRepo
getFormFactor(HadronicUID processId) const Hammer::ProvidersRepovirtual
getLog() const Hammer::ProvidersRepoprivate
getPartialWidth(PdgId parent, const std::vector< PdgId > &daughters, const std::vector< PdgId > &granddaughters={}) const Hammer::ProvidersRepovirtual
getRate(PdgId parent, const std::vector< PdgId > &daughters, const std::vector< PdgId > &granddaughters={}) const Hammer::ProvidersRepovirtual
getSetting(const std::string &name) const Hammer::SettingsConsumerprotected
getSetting(const std::string &otherPath, const std::string &name) const Hammer::SettingsConsumerprotected
getSettingsHandler() const Hammer::SettingsConsumer
getWCLabel(const std::string &wcPrefix) const Hammer::ProvidersRepo
getWCProvider(const std::string &wcPrefix) const Hammer::ProvidersRepo
initialize()Hammer::ProvidersRepo
initializeFFErrs()Hammer::ProvidersRepoprivate
initializeWCs()Hammer::ProvidersRepoprivate
initPostSchemeDefs()Hammer::ProvidersRepo
initPreSchemeDefs()Hammer::ProvidersRepo
initSettings()Hammer::SettingsConsumerprotected
isOn(const std::string &name) const Hammer::SettingsConsumerprotected
isOn(const std::string &otherPath, const std::string &name) const Hammer::SettingsConsumerprotected
operator=(const ProvidersRepo &other)=deleteHammer::ProvidersRepo
operator=(ProvidersRepo &&other)=deleteHammer::ProvidersRepo
Hammer::SettingsConsumer::operator=(const SettingsConsumer &)=defaultHammer::SettingsConsumer
ProvidersRepo(const SchemeDefinitions *schemeDefs)Hammer::ProvidersRepo
ProvidersRepo(const ProvidersRepo &other)=deleteHammer::ProvidersRepo
ProvidersRepo(ProvidersRepo &&other)=deleteHammer::ProvidersRepo
removeSetting(const std::string &name)Hammer::SettingsConsumerprotected
schemeNamesFromPrefixAndGroup(const FFPrefixGroup &value) const Hammer::ProvidersRepo
setPath(const std::string &path)Hammer::SettingsConsumerprotected
setSettingsHandler(SettingsHandler &sh)Hammer::ProvidersRepovirtual
Hammer::SettingsConsumer::setSettingsHandler(const SettingsConsumer &other)Hammer::SettingsConsumer
SettingsConsumer()Hammer::SettingsConsumer
SettingsConsumer(const SettingsConsumer &)=defaultHammer::SettingsConsumer
setWeightTerm(WTerm group)Hammer::SettingsConsumer
updateVectorOfSettings(const std::vector< T > &values, const std::vector< std::string > &names, const std::string &path="", WTerm group=WTerm::COMMON)Hammer::SettingsConsumerprotected
updateVectorOfSettings(const std::map< std::string, T > &values, const std::string &path="", WTerm group=WTerm::COMMON)Hammer::SettingsConsumerprotected
~ProvidersRepo() noexceptHammer::ProvidersRepovirtual
~SettingsConsumer()Hammer::SettingsConsumerinlinevirtual